University Park, Ill.  The Holy Cross College men’s basketball team traveled to Governors State University this evening for a Chicagoland Collegiate Athletic Conference matchup. The Saints trailed 41-40 heading into halftime. Holy Cross would outscore the Jaguars 34-24 in the second half as they would go on to win 74-65. With the win, men’s basketball improves to 6-2 overall and 1-1 in league play while GSU stands at 3-6 and 1-2.
